Handover — Vexler partner SFTP drop

Ownership moves to you today. Drop runs hourly from Vexler's end into the intake bucket via the relay host. Watch for zero-byte files; their exporter flakes on Mondays. Creds live in the ops vault, path noted in the runbook. Vault auto-seals after 48h idle. Support escalations go to the on-call rotation, not me. If the vault is sealed when you need it, unseal with the recovery passphrase below.

recovery phrase for tadug-fafof: zorwyn-kasion

**Fan-out Backpressure (Brindlehook Notify)**

When a notification fan-out exceeds the per-plugin delivery budget, Brindlehook Notify applies backpressure by returning a 429 with a `X-Drain-After` header rather than dropping events. Plugin authors should pause enqueueing until the drain window elapses, then resume at half the prior rate. To inspect your current budget and queue depth, call the internal quota service, authenticating with the key below:

app token of hawif-yaguf = kto15_D1YHEykrtxKxx7V

# remindersvc.env — ClinicPing appointment reminder job
# Reviewer notes: this cron-driven job texts patients 24h before their visit
# at the Oakhollow clinic. Schedule and retry knobs are below; don't touch
# RETRY_MAX unless the gateway team signs off. Everything here is safe to
# commit except the messaging gateway credential, which gets injected at
# deploy time. The injector appends that credential right after this comment.

env line for yahip-tafog: RELAY_SECRET3=4ca